Histocompatibility antigens and myocardial infarction
Tissue Antigens
|November 1, 1977
Summary
This study investigated the link between Human Leukocyte Antigen (HLA) types and ischemic heart disease in Edinburgh men. No significant differences in HLA antigen frequencies were found, refuting a proposed association.

Purpose of the Study:
- To investigate the association between specific HLA antigens and haplotypes (HLA-B8, A1-B8) and the risk of myocardial infarction (heart attack).
Main Methods:
- HLA typing was performed on a cohort of 50 men under 45 who had experienced myocardial infarction.
- A control group of 96 healthy men aged 40 was randomly selected from the same community for comparison.
Main Results:
- Analysis revealed no statistically significant differences in the frequencies of HLA antigen types between the myocardial infarction group and the healthy control group.
- Specifically, the frequencies of HLA-B8 and the A1-B8 haplotype did not differ significantly between the two groups.
Conclusions:
- The findings do not support the hypothesis that HLA-B8 or the A1-B8 haplotype are associated with an increased risk of ischemic heart disease.
